The VingCard 2100 is an offline electronic locking system. This means the individual door locks do not communicate wirelessly with a central server. Instead, data is transferred via the data track on the magnetic stripe cards encoded at your front desk terminal. Key Components
A handheld device used by maintenance staff to initialize locks, upload time-and-date data, and extract audit trails.
